Craft Birdhouses
Craft Birdhouses
This is a craft that my mother-in-law and I made. It uses empty seed packets. Pick 6 of your favorite images for the project. I prefer to use 2 of the same for the roof. We hot glued the packages to a block of styrofoam. We used 2 packages for the roof. Carefully open the lids to act as an overhang. You can also use a piece of cardboard for the roof. We also included moss for the space between the roof and sides. For the ledge for the front of the birdhouse, look for items in your garden for the mushroom birds to sit on. Ours used a cinnamon stick. Decorate the top of the birdhouse with snippets of floral items. Enjoy!
